Turn molecular biology into the X-ray aesthetic — proteins, DNA, viruses, enzymes rendered as glowing white translucent structures on black, medical imaging style. Pair with a Flux Canny or Depth ControlNet of a real PDB structure for a scientifically accurate molecule in this style, or prompt freely for bio-art.
Trigger word: xray_molecular
Recommended settings: LoRA strength 0.8 to 1.0, Steps 28-34, Guidance 3.5 to 4.5
Example prompts:
. xray_molecular, a protein molecule, dramatic, high detail
. xray_molecular, a DNA double helix
. xray_molecular, a virus capsid, symmetric
. xray_molecular, an enzyme active site
Training: rank 16, EMA 0.99, ~1000 steps on Flux.1-dev with ControlNet-guided synthetic dataset of 24 real PDB structures.
